  • Terence Daniels and the Rise of the Cactus Club
    Nov 12 2025
    Matt Cook discusses the lack of a golf community in Arizona with guest Terence Daniels, highlighting the Cactus Club and Matt's return to podcasting. Terence shares his golf journey from high school to Scottsdale, touching on amateur golf and handling tournament pressure. They reflect on professional encounters and memories from the GCU golf team. The episode delves into the Cactus Club's purpose, growth, and Terence's involvement in golf modeling. The conversation covers Arizona's exclusive golf clubs and the Cactus Club's expansion, with a nod to sponsor Devereux Golf. Terence's career in golf style and modeling, along with his future projects, are explored, concluding with the signature pull hook moment question.

  • The Rise of Marty Sanchez
    Oct 31 2025
    Matt Cook welcomes Marty Sanchez to discuss the Grass League and Marty's transition from college golfer to professional. They delve into insights gained from caddying and the league's structure, exploring its challenges and Marty's role within it. Marty shares his experience as the face of DevRow's High Country Collection, emphasizing vulnerability and brand-building in golf. The episode highlights the importance of collaboration, emotional expression, and composure on the course. Marty discusses his favorite outfits from the collection, Devereux Golf's mission, and shares personal stories. The conversation covers learning from setbacks, future plans, and enhancing Marty's online presence, with closing thoughts and appreciation.
